The hole in the back of the mobo tray is not for a fan... as it wouldn't fit between the side of the case and the tray. but it is for rear retentin plates, and removing waterblocks/TECs/Phase/BIG air coolers before you remove the tray... since the backplates/retention plates, usually are the bolt anchors...
